I like my Huel watery personally so don’t use plant milk as it makes it too thick.
I tend to always full my shaker to the 700ml mark regardless of whether I’ve added 2 scoops or 3.

I have used hazelnut milk to add flavour, but I tend to use only a small amount to stop it thickening up too much.

Different brands of plant milk have different thickeners though, so they will all behave differently.
Experimenting til you get your own perfect ratio is about the only way to get it right
